Output e737944ec1745f55f2c97f558a5545ea0ad935341a6670359bde2bb4baf65c78:0

value
21600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02626c5ef0ddabc25d36a5cf8f96419a5340860 OP_EQUAL
address
3LfcBFhW9oqLmDJULnGMcMmzBQK4EU3bFU
transaction
e737944ec1745f55f2c97f558a5545ea0ad935341a6670359bde2bb4baf65c78
confirmations
395595
spent
true